Terrific news! I have just found out (Feb.
21, 2002) that Disney
is selling copies of a 1981 24-minute version of the video at their Teacher Store!
(Product ID 68650) They are not cheap: $79 + $5 shipping
-- but that's a typical institutional price for videos with the following license:
"Disney videos sold in this catalog may be shown by nonprofit educational institutions
(or their equivalents) for face-to-face instructional purposes. Purchase of videos
also includes a license for transmission or broadcast within a single building or
school campus, and for showing in connection with other nonteaching school-related
activities, as long as no admission fee is charged. Transmission or broadcasting
into or beyond a school campus or its equivalent is strictly prohibited unless separately
authorized by Disney." [Quoted from the site] I have not seen this particular
video yet, and would like to hear from anyone who has. My grandfather was especially pleased that the filming was done on location in Polynesia (note the distinctive volcanic profile of Bora Bora in the image above), and that the actors were cast entirely from the native population.
